A former waterworks building houses a great little museum with exhibits on the Penobscot tribe and on local logging. You'll also find early area ... More on An Explorer's Guide: Maine
overview: The Museum brings together important aspects of Old TownÂs rich heritage with a particular focus on the strong role that the lumbering industry has played in local history. Both rotating ... More on MuseumStuff.com
